If something is urgent, stop and get help

Nothing here is meant for urgent situations. Call your local emergency number —112 in Germany and the EU, 999 in the UK, 911 in the US and Canada — for anything sudden or severe, such as chest pain, difficulty breathing, weakness or numbness on one side, trouble speaking, or a sudden severe headache.

If you are having thoughts of harming yourself, please contact a crisis line now. In Germany, Telefonseelsorge is free and answers day and night on 0800 111 0 111.

Never change prescribed treatment because of something here

Do not start, stop or alter any medication or therapy on the basis of this content, and do not use it to delay seeking care. If something here seems relevant to your treatment, raise it with the person treating you. Stopping some medication abruptly — or stopping regular heavy drinking abruptly — can be dangerous in itself and needs medical supervision.
